**Night Shift — Recording Studio (Room 4B)**

The Fennick Media training studio runs unattended overnight. Check the booking sheet before entering. Power down lights and teleprompter after any maintenance. Do not move camera rigs; they are marked on the floor. Report faults in the night log, not by phone. Lock the equipment cage before leaving. The studio door uses a keypad; enter with the code below.

badge for fahap-kahof: bdg-EQUNTN-00774017

**Action item (PM-2291, Skidgate incident):** Retune the Parcelhound typo-squat scanner thresholds. The edit-distance cutoff was too loose, flooding triage with false positives, while the download-velocity trigger fired too late. Owners must rerun the calibration suite after any change and record results in the scanner runbook. Agreed values are set out below.

tuning constants:
QUOTAS = {
    "druwyn": 5,
    "holix": 5,
    "zorath": 5,
    "holwyn": 10,
}

## Releases

Packlite (the telemetry payload compressor) releases whenever the compression benchmarks pass on the reference corpus. Reviewers: check that ratio and CPU numbers are in the PR description before approving. Builds get signed at publish time, no exceptions. The publish script expects the signing key, which follows.

deploy key for hawef-yadup: bky19_kVT4YunTZZSTyhFQQoK

Subject: Payroll export format — new ownership

Hi all,

As of this sprint, the Ledgerline payroll export is moving from fixed-width to the new delimited format. New joiners: please use the updated spec on the Finhollow wiki and ignore the legacy templates. Questions about the migration, cutover dates, or validation rules should go to the new owner.

approver of yawig-yajef = Briius Jorix